How To Write Resume For Grants Administrator
- Highlight your experience in managing large grant portfolios and negotiating favorable terms.
- Quantify your accomplishments whenever possible, using specific metrics to demonstrate the impact of your work.
- Demonstrate your understanding of grant regulations and best practices, as well as your commitment to compliance.
- Showcase your ability to work independently and as part of a team, and highlight your communication and interpersonal skills.
- Proofread your resume carefully for any errors, and make sure it is well-organized and easy to read.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Grants Administrator
What is the role of a Grants Administrator?
A Grants Administrator is responsible for managing the entire grant lifecycle, from identifying funding opportunities and developing proposals to negotiating terms, managing budgets, and ensuring compliance with regulations. They work closely with program staff, funding agencies, and grantees to ensure that grants are used effectively and efficiently.
What skills are required to be a successful Grants Administrator?
Successful Grants Administrators typically have a strong understanding of grant regulations and best practices, as well as experience in grant proposal writing, program evaluation, and budget management. They are also excellent communicators and have a proven track record of working effectively with a variety of stakeholders.
What are the career prospects for Grants Administrators?
Grants Administrators can advance their careers by taking on more senior roles within their organizations, such as Grants Manager or Director of Grants. They can also move into related fields, such as fundraising or program management.
What is the salary range for Grants Administrators?
The salary range for Grants Administrators can vary depending on experience, location, and organization size. According to Salary.com, the median salary for Grants Administrators in the United States is $65,000.
What are the most common challenges faced by Grants Administrators?
Some of the most common challenges faced by Grants Administrators include managing multiple grants simultaneously, ensuring compliance with complex regulations, and working with limited resources. They must also be able to effectively communicate with a variety of stakeholders, including funding agencies, grantees, and program staff.
What advice would you give to someone who is interested in becoming a Grants Administrator?
To become a successful Grants Administrator, I recommend that you gain experience in grant writing, program evaluation, and budget management. You should also develop a strong understanding of grant regulations and best practices. Networking with other Grants Administrators and attending industry events can also be helpful.
